The converter converts kilograms to liters for Steel (Carbon) using the fixed table density 7850 kg/m^3. For this material-specific pair, calculator values and table rows follow the same constant-factor model so mirror direction remains numerically consistent. Standard engineering density for carbon steel.
Formula: Liters (Steel (Carbon)) = Kilograms (Steel (Carbon)) × 0.127389. Why: this page converts between kilograms (steel (carbon)) and liters (steel (carbon)) for Steel (Carbon) using one page-specific material density basis.
Fixed material density table value: 7850 kg/m^3.
